The probability of choosing a 10 is 4/52; likewise a Jack is 4/52. The probability of 10 or Jack is 4/52 + 4/52 = 8/52 or 2/13.

The probability of drawing a 10 out of 52 cards is 4 in 52, or 1 in 13, or about 0.07692.
